Banco de dados no BrOffice Base

1. Banco de dados no BrOffice Base

Fábio Farias
Fabio_Farias

(usa openSUSE)

Enviado em 18/02/2011 - 23:24h

Olá Pessoal!
Preciso de uma ajdua com relação à um banco de dados que estou montando para uso no meu trabalho.

Eu criei uma tabela como mostra nessa imagem: http://img254.imageshack.us/i/47072057.jpg/
Aqui tem uma imagem desta tabela já com os dados inseridos: http://img200.imageshack.us/i/56316623.jpg/

Aqui tem o modelo de formulário que criei: http://img337.imageshack.us/i/36319202.jpg/

E por fim aqui tem o relatório gerado pelo assistente do Base: http://img194.imageshack.us/i/60347732.jpg/

O que eu gostaria de modificar é no relatório:
- Onde o campo "Conselheiro" fica vazio na tabela gostaria que ficasse em "Branco" no relatório ao invés de aparecer aquele "0" (Zero).
- Onde o campo "Conselheiro" estivesse "ticado", "Marcado" (V) na tabela eu gostaria que ficasse "ticado" (V) ou com um "X" no Relatório.

Como posso fazer isso?

Nota: É claro que o banco de dados tem outros campos. Eu simplifiquei aqui pois o campo onde preciso de ajuda é o campo "Conselheiro" onde deve estar ou não marcado.

Desde já agradeço a atenção de todos!


  


2. Re: Banco de dados no BrOffice Base

Fábio Farias
Fabio_Farias

(usa openSUSE)

Enviado em 19/02/2011 - 12:55h

Alguém?


3. Boa tarde!

Ana Cristina Conceição da Silva Freitas
anafrei

(usa openSUSE)

Enviado em 19/02/2011 - 14:02h

Fábio, não sei vai ajudar, mas esta semana elaborei um banco de dados para a Escola onde dou Aula de Música. E no lugar onde definia se era professor, ou aluno eu usei códigos, como P:para professor, A:para aluno.
No seu caso poderia testar qual o código que se adequa a sua tabela.
Desculpa por não poder te ajudar mais. Espero que os Amigos te possam ajudar! Abraços!


4. Re: Banco de dados no BrOffice Base

Joao
stack_of

(usa Slackware)

Enviado em 19/02/2011 - 14:38h

Não sei se é isso que você precisa, aliás nem uso o BASE do OpenOffice, mas acredito que para resolver seu problema você vai ter de alterar o valor default no campo.

Verifica se tem alguma opção em Ferramentas(Tools)->SQL.

Execute um comando assim:

alter table suatabela alter column suacoluna set default '';


5. Re: Banco de dados no BrOffice Base

Fábio Farias
Fabio_Farias

(usa openSUSE)

Enviado em 19/02/2011 - 14:57h

stack_of

Eu executei esse comando no local indicado:

alter table "Conselho" alter column "Conselheiro" set "default"

E ele retornou o seguinte erro:

Unexpected token: default in statement [alter table "Conselho" alter column "Conselheiro" set "default"]

Onde estou errando?


6. Re: Banco de dados no BrOffice Base

Joao
stack_of

(usa Slackware)

Enviado em 19/02/2011 - 18:13h

Acho que seria assim:

alter table "Conselho" alter column "Conselheiro" set default '';


7. Re: Banco de dados no BrOffice Base

Joao
stack_of

(usa Slackware)

Enviado em 19/02/2011 - 18:17h

A palavra default faz parte da declaração (statement) do SQL, não pode ter aspas.


8. Re: Banco de dados no BrOffice Base

Fábio Farias
Fabio_Farias

(usa openSUSE)

Enviado em 19/02/2011 - 19:52h

Funcionou amigo. Obrigado.
Mas em que parte do Banco de dados devo incluir esse comando para que altere o resultado do relatório.
NO local indicado: Ferramentas>SQL ele apenas executa o comando e retorna como "comando realizado com sucesso"

Abraços!


9. Re: Banco de dados no BrOffice Base

Joao
stack_of

(usa Slackware)

Enviado em 20/02/2011 - 09:09h

O comando que você executou altera o esquema do banco de dados. Não sei onde alterar as propriedades de uma tabela no BASE.
Nota: antes de alterar qualquer coisa é melhor fazer um backup do trabalho.






Patrocínio

Site hospedado pelo provedor RedeHost.
Linux banner

Destaques

Artigos

Dicas

Tópicos

Top 10 do mês

Scripts